1

我正在使用 Compact Framework 中的 SerialPort 类,但我无法接收超过 2047 个字节。我可以接收的字节数是否存在任何限制?或如何设置对象?我正在尝试使用 WriteBufferSize 和 ReadBufferSize 属性,但它们不起作用。

4

2 回答 2

1

我的猜测是它要么是处理器限制,要么是平台限制。来自 MSDN 论坛的这篇文章似乎证实了我的怀疑。

于 2008-09-04T01:47:37.527 回答
0

您可以设置一个线程将数据拉入您自己分配的另一个(更大)缓冲区吗?我会说这是最好的解决方法。

于 2008-11-05T16:51:37.623 回答